The 2-Minute Rule for C++ assignment help



For most code, even the difference between stack allocation and free of charge-retail store allocation doesn’t matter, but the advantage and safety of vector does.

Great-tuned memory buy could be effective exactly where receive load is much more effective than sequentially-reliable load

Unintentionally leaving out a break is a reasonably common bug. A deliberate fallthrough is usually a routine maintenance hazard.

This would be fantastic if there was a default initialization for SomeLargeType that wasn’t way too expensive.

An invariant is rational affliction for that customers of the item that a constructor will have to create for the public member capabilities to suppose.

: a named device of code that could be invoked (identified as) from distinctive portions of a method; a reasonable device of computation.

???? should there become a “use X instead of std::async” where by X is something that would use a far better specified thread pool?

The perfect is “just upgrade every linked here little thing.” That offers by far the most Added benefits for the shortest overall time.

How best to get it done is determined by the code, the force for updates, the backgrounds of the builders, and the accessible Software.

The overly-generic pair and tuple really should be utilised only when the value returned represents to impartial entities rather then click here to find out more an abstraction.

A reliable and finish technique for managing problems and resource leaks is difficult to retrofit into a technique.

In that circumstance, have an vacant default or else it's difficult to understand in the event you meant to manage all cases:

Now, there's no specific mention with the iteration system, as well special info as the loop operates over a reference to const elements making sure that accidental modification are unable to take place. If modification is wished-for, say so:

: the act of trying to find and getting rid of errors from the program; generally far fewer systematic than tests.

Leave a Reply

Your email address will not be published. Required fields are marked *